免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发中适用的短信sdk

在移动应用开发中,短信SDK是一种用于发送和接收短信的工具包。它可以帮助开发者轻松集成短信功能到他们的应用程序中,实现发送验证码、短信通知等功能。本文将介绍几种常用的短信SDK,并详细解释它们的原理和使用方法。

1. Mob短信SDK

Mob短信SDK是一款功能强大且易于使用的短信发送工具。它提供了丰富的API接口,开发者可以通过调用这些接口实现短信发送功能。Mob短信SDK的原理是通过与运营商的网关进行通信,将短信内容发送到指定的手机号码。开发者需要在Mob官网注册账号并获取AppKey和AppSecret,然后在应用程序中配置这些信息,即可使用Mob短信SDK发送短信。

2. 阿里云短信SDK

阿里云短信SDK是阿里云提供的一款短信发送工具。它基于阿里云的短信服务平台,提供了丰富的接口和功能。阿里云短信SDK的原理是通过与阿里云的短信网关进行通信,将短信内容发送到指定的手机号码。开发者需要在阿里云官网注册账号并创建短信服务,然后在应用程序中配置AccessKey和AccessSecret,即可使用阿里云短信SDK发送短信。

3. 腾讯云短信SDK

腾讯云短信SDK是腾讯云提供的一款短信发送工具。它基于腾讯云的短信服务平台,提供了简单易用的API接口。腾讯云短信SDK的原理与前两种SDK类似,也是通过与腾讯云的短信网关进行通信,将短信内容发送到指定的手机号码。开发者需要在腾讯云官网注册账号并创建短信服务,然后在应用程序中配置SecretId和SecretKey,即可使用腾讯云短信SDK发送短信。

除了上述的短信SDK,还有一些其他的短信SDK也值得一提,如极光短信SDK、易信短信SDK等。这些短信SDK的原理和使用方法大致相似,开发者可以根据自己的需求选择合适的SDK进行集成。

总结起来,短信SDK是移动应用开发中常用的工具之一,它可以帮助开发者实现短信发送功能。不同的短信SDK有不同的原理和使用方法,但它们的核心都是通过与运营商的短信网关进行通信,将短信内容发送到指定的手机号码。开发者在集成短信SDK时,需要注册账号并获取相应的API密钥,然后在应用程序中配置这些信息,即可使用短信SDK发送短信。


相关知识:
日照app开发价格
日照市是山东省的一个经济发达城市,拥有丰富的旅游资源和商业机会,因此开发一款专门为日照市服务的APP是非常有前途和必要的。但是,APP开发的价格是一个让很多人感到困惑和不知所措的问题。本文将会介绍APP开发的原理和详细的价格介绍,希望对需要开发日照APP的
2024-01-10
flutter能开发社区app吗
当然可以!Flutter是一个跨平台的移动应用开发框架,它可以让开发者使用一套代码同时构建iOS和Android应用。Flutter具有丰富的UI组件和强大的性能,非常适合开发社区型的应用。要开发一个社区型的app,首先需要明确你的app需要具备什么功能。
2023-07-14
app软开发案例
APP软开发是指在移动设备上开发应用程序,为用户提供各种服务和娱乐。本文将介绍APP软开发的原理和详细介绍。APP软开发的原理包括需求分析、设计、开发、测试和发布等阶段。需求分析阶段是确定APP的功能和需求,了解用户的需求和使用场景,为开发提供基础。设计阶
2023-07-14
app注册开发商
App注册开发商是指开发手机应用程序的公司或个人,他们负责设计、开发和发布手机应用程序。在这篇文章中,我将详细介绍App注册开发商的原理和流程。首先,要成为一个注册开发商,你需要注册一个开发者账号。不同的手机平台有不同的注册流程,比如iOS需要注册成为Ap
2023-07-14
app为什么不建议选择模板开发
在选择开发一个应用程序时,我们常常会面临一个选择:是使用模板开发还是从零开始自定义开发。模板开发是使用预先设计好的通用模板和功能组件来构建应用程序,而自定义开发则是从头开始编写代码来满足特定需求。虽然模板开发具有一定的优势,但在大多数情况下,不建议选择模板
2023-07-14
app开发的实践意义与价值
随着移动互联网的发展,越来越多的人开始使用智能手机进行日常生活和工作。而这些功能强大的设备也推动了app开发的繁荣发展,成为了移动互联网技术的核心之一。那么,app开发有什么实践意义和价值呢?让我们一起来探讨一下。一、实践意义1. 提高用户体验开发一个优秀
2023-06-29